Hamburg Ballet makes Chinese return after 13 years

The Hamburg Ballet will perform A Midsummer Night's Dream at the National Centre for the Performing Arts in Beijing between March 28 and 30.

One of Shakespeare's most beloved comedies, A Midsummer Night's Dream is a tale of love, magic and mischief set in a world where reality and dreams intertwine. In 1977, choreographer John Neumeier reimagined the classic through ballet, preserving its whimsical charm while using movement to express the complexities of love and human relationships. His choreography masterfully merged classical ballet with contemporary dance, allowing each character's emotions to shine through nuanced movement and theatrical storytelling.

Beyond its choreography, the ballet's music blends a poetic score by Mendelssohn with the ethereal organ and mechanical sounds of Hungarian-born composer Gyorgy Ligeti, creating an enchanting atmosphere. The stage design is minimalist and symbolic, weaving historical elements into the set, while costumes use color and texture to distinguish the human and fairy worlds, enhancing the ballet's magical quality.

"Throughout my career, I have believed in telling stories through the silent language of dance. Shakespeare wrote A Midsummer Night's Dream over 500 years ago, and today, it continues to transcend time and borders. We are thrilled to bring this ballet from Germany to China, creating a bridge across cultures through art," says Neumeier.

As the former artistic director of the company, Neumeier, a visionary choreographer known for his deep storytelling and humanistic approach, shaped the Hamburg Ballet for over 50 years, creating 170 original productions that blend classical ballet with contemporary expression. His pioneering work has elevated the company to global acclaim. The company's new artistic director, Demis Volpi, himself a choreographer, brings a fresh artistic perspective, expanding the company's repertoire while honoring its heritage.
